For instance, if the meter was read last month and the ERT sent out a 1 and this month it is sending out a 0 then it needs to be looked at because the meter has moved. ERT modules also give us tamper counts to let us know if the position of the meter has changed since the last time the meter was read. As long as the black dot passes by the sensor the ERT counts it as being one revolution. This is because since the ERT only counts pulses it does not matter which way the disk turns. If they are very different then it is possible that the customer has been tampering with the meter by turning the meter upside down. This can also be used as a way to detect meter tampering in an AMR metering system because the mechanical register and the ERT register should always match.
This counts the number of times that it sees the black dot and uses preprogrammed information to determine how many Kwh have been used. This black dot passes over a sensor in the ERT module. In electromechanical meters, the disk that spins, has a black dot that is painted on it. In electromechanical meters the ERT can be thought of as a second meter register. For an electromechanical meter to work in an AMR metering system, the meter will need to be retrofitted with the ERT module. So, in an AMR metering system the ERT collects the data from the AMR meter and then transmits the information to the collection device.
There were also 40 series ERTs for gas and water as well. Gas AMR meters have 60g and 100g series ERTs. Electric AMR meters typically use 41 series ERTs and 45 series ERTs while water AMR meters use 60w and 100 w ERTs. ERT modules are also used on mechanical and digital water and gas meters as well. Electric, water and gas meters all have these ERT modules installed under glass.Įlectromechanical electric meters as well as digital electric meters both take advantage and use ERT modules to communicate readings back to the mobile collectors.
